Support rods made of Native Oak by LACKER NATURE
The support rods from LACKER NATURE are ideal for tying and securing young
plants and for use our tree protectors. Made from locally sourced oak, the
stakes are air-dried, four-sided planed, and pointed – making them stable,
durable and easy to install. Once in place, they can remain in the ground and
will naturally return to the ecosystem.

Sustainable forestry
The oak used comes from responsibly managed, PEFC-certified forests. LACKER NATURE is committed to careful, resource-efficient processing – from regional harvesting to long-lasting use.
Durable and resistant
Oak is naturally robust and weather-resistant. With straight, sapwood-free cuts, these stakes ensure a long service life.
It's wood – not waste
LACKER NATURE also makes use of local oak affected by the oak splendour beetle. The fine bore marks left behind do not affect the woods strength or quality. Once felled and dried, the beetle cannot survive – allowing the valuable material to be repurposed sustainably as strong and useful plant stakes.
